At 10:05 PM, Bella took Leon to the hospital with a worried expression. She herself didn't understand why she was so worried about Leon. Could it be because Leon's face resembled the young master of the Vint family, thus fostering a deep sense of sympathy in her feelings? That was the question that briefly crossed her mind.

When they arrived at the hospital, the nurses there immediately took care of Leon, until some time later, Leon's examination was completed.

"How is he, Senior?" Bella asked when the door opened and revealed a tall, rather muscular man coming out of there.

"Let's talk in my office," the handsome man replied.

Bella then walked following the man until she arrived in a room.

"Before I tell you his condition, I want to ask. Who is that man? I've never seen him before."

Bella was silent for a moment. The man wearing medical clothes in front of her was Doctor Edward, her senior when she was in college. Because of her beauty and intelligence, she managed to captivate Edward.

Edward's love story wasn't as good as people's, because until now, he still hadn't gotten Bella's love. The last time he declared his love for Bella for the umpteenth time was when they were about to graduate. There, Bella still gave the same answer, which was to reject him. Even so, Edward was still waiting for Bella to accept his love.

Bella herself didn't dislike Edward. If it was just because of his face, Edward wasn't less handsome than Leon. However, in her heart, she still hoped that Leon wasn't dead and would return someday. She didn't know how long her heart would be tired of waiting, then accept another to enter her heart.

"A distant relative of mine. He's a distant relative of mine," Bella replied with a confident tone.

Edward was silent after hearing that. He then opened his computer and looked at Leon's examination results.

"What was he doing before you found him unconscious?" Edward asked.

"I don't know for sure. I was in the bathroom at that time."

Hearing that statement, Edward stopped his index finger scrolling the mouse for a moment. So, they lived under one roof? A distant relative? Why didn't I ever know she had a distant relative? That was the question that managed to make him daydream for a moment.

"Before going to the bathroom, I left him eating smoked brisket. Or, could it be that he's allergic to beef?"

Edward turned his attention to Bella. "His condition is fine. His body is healthy. There's no history of illness, no history of allergies."

Bella frowned slightly for a moment. Fine? Even though before she had touched Leon's body, which was like a hot pan.

"Look. This is the result we got after the examination. Everything is normal," Edward continued, showing the monitor to Bella.

Edward tried to explain the data displayed on his computer, making Bella listen and understand seriously. Yep, everything was normal.

"Maybe he fainted just because of fatigue. At the latest, he'll regain consciousness tomorrow. Let him rest first."

Bella sighed lightly and replied, "Um... alright."

After that, Bella rose from her seat and left from there.

As she walked with her back to Edward to the door, Edward's eyes seemed unwilling to let go of the woman. He only diverted his gaze when Bella had really left from there.

...

In the VIP room, a reddish-black aura still enveloped Leon's body. Even now, small red lines like embers could be seen on both his hands and neck, forming and connecting like blood vessels.

Inside his Sea Of Consciousness, the existence of his soul seemed to be sitting cross-legged on an ancient designed round altar. Around the altar was a stretch of pool of water, which was orange because it was exposed to the orange sky light.

Leon sat cross-legged without clothes, thus clearly showing the shape of his muscular muscles. Like on his physical body, the reddish-black aura and also the lines that connected like blood vessels colored embers seemed to envelop the existence of his soul. This was the heart demon phenomenon, which brought out the cruel side in Leon.

In the legend, even though the existence of the ancient heavenly body was very special, someone who was destined with that body was very difficult to embark on the path of cultivation. Even if they could cultivate, the consequence was that they could only reach the purification level of the transformation phase. If they stubbornly broke through to the next level, then a heart demon would form in their soul.

Since he broke through the Amplification level, Leon could survive from the heart demon only because of the seal that Master Lu had implanted in him. Even though the seal wasn't easily destroyed, still, the unwanted things could happen, like what Leon was experiencing now.

Basically, the heart demon was very strong. What was currently attacking Leon was just a ray of its aura. So, the only solution was that Leon had to find a way how to defeat and eliminate the heart demon.

If he didn't find a way soon, then his original soul would continue to erode, slowly until it was exhausted. As a result, the existence of his soul would be taken over and he would truly become a bloodthirsty demon.

On the bed, in an unconscious state, Leon writhed like a worm under the sun. The pain felt by the existence of his soul made his physical body uncomfortable. If he could scream, maybe at this moment he would have screamed in pain.

Some moments later, his body slowly calmed down, but the reddish-black aura still enveloped his body. Suddenly...

BOOM

An explosion of spiritual energy occurred, sending wind in all directions, slightly shifting the objects around, as Leon suddenly opened his eyes wide. His pupils glowed red, like a terrifying monster awakened from its sleep.

On the other side, Bella walked along the corridor. She didn't seem to be focused on the road in front of her, so much so that she accidentally bumped into a man.

"Ah, sorry," Bella said spontaneously.

The man only looked at Bella with a slight frown. He shook his head slightly for a moment and left from there.

Bella sighed before she took another step.

"I should have rested tonight. Unfortunately, many unexpected things happened. Now, I even have to take care of a stranger who I haven't known for a day."

"But why do I seem to have to take care of him? No. Bella, when he regains consciousness tomorrow, you have to find him a place to live. He's nobody. It's not good for a man to live in the same house as a woman either."

As she uttered those sentences in her heart, Bella suddenly realized that she was in front of Leon's room. Without hesitation, she opened the door, but immediately frowned when she saw that the room was a bit messy.

"Huh? Leon?!" she exclaimed.
